Abstract

ABSTRACT

A system for cryptographically verifying autonomous agents in merchant transaction systems includes a verification server configured to receive a transaction request from a terminal agent in a multi-agent delegation chain. The verification server parses a delegation chain manifest from the transaction request, wherein the delegation chain manifest comprises a linked list of signed hop records, each hop record capturing a delegation event from a delegator to a delegate. The verification server verifies, for each hop record in the delegation chain manifest, a delegator signature against a public key retrieved from an agent registry. The verification server verifies a hash chain linking each hop record to a previous hop record in the delegation chain manifest. The verification server forwards the transaction request to a merchant backend responsive to successful verification of the delegation chain manifest.

Creative Commons License

Creative Commons License
This work is licensed under a Creative Commons Attribution 4.0 License.

Share

COinS